User Share Completely Disappeared

Featured Replies

I have no idea where to go with this and I am afraid to try anything on my own.

 

I *had* a user share called 'Pictures' with a handful of folders and thousands of files.  It has completely disappeared and I have no how or why or when.  What is more confounding is that I do not see a Pictures folder on any single disk (/mnt/disk1, /mnt/disk2, etc.).

 

How could a user share and all content within it just up and vanish?  I have not had any drives redball.  I certainly did not delete all the files/folders AND delete the share from the console.  I don't have any dockers or VMs that interact with that share.

 

I have attached my diagnostics file although I don't think it will provide much help.  Any help/guidance would be greatly appreciated (especially if it prevents my wife from killing me).

This does sound strange - I have never heard of files disappearing without trace.  The strange thing is that looking at the config files I cannot see any signs of a 'Pictures' share (although share names are obfuscated it could show on of the form 'P....s.cfg'.  Could you have accidentally renamed the share?   Could you have moved the top level folder to be inside another one (this would be almost instantaneous so might get missed if done accidentally).

 

Do you have Disk Shares activated?   If so a top level folder of the form 'diskN' on one of your data drives might cause unexpected things to happen. 

 

Do you have any dockers that have access to the /mnt/user path (with no further sub-folder specified)?   If so they would potentially have access to all user shares (including the Pictures share).    The same might apply if any had access to the /mnt/diskN type path.

 

Do you have backups - this is certainly something you SHOULD have backups of.
